SOMERS (Bettystown, Co. Meath and formerly of Rathmines, Dublin) - December 14, 2016, (peacefully), in the care of the MISA Unit, St. James's Hospital, after a long illness bravely fought, Joseph M. (Joe), beloved husband of Muriel and loving father of Fiona and Ciarán; deeply regretted by his son-in-law John, daughter-in-law Susan, his beloved grandchildren Aisling, Aidan and Emma, brother Pat, sisters-in-law Anne, Shelagh and Annabelle, nephews, nieces, cousin Peter, his extended family in Ireland and Australia and his many friends. Reposing at his home today (Friday) from 5 o'c until 8 o'clock Funeral Mass tomorrow (Saturday) at 11 o'c in the Church of the Sacred Heart, Laytown. Burial afterwards in Reilig Mhuire, Piltown.Ar dheis Dé go raibh a anam
